SWINDON Town manager Richie Wellens has been handed a two-game touchline ban and a £1,000 fine after being found guilty of improper conduct by the Football Association.

Wellens’ charge relates to an alleged incident in the tunnel area during the half-time interval of Town's 3-0 Carabao Cup defeat to Colchester United. 

A brief statement on Swindon Town's website reads: 

"The club can today confirm that manager, Richie Wellens will serve a two-match touchline ban following his charge of improper conduct by the FA.

"Richie will be in the stands for tomorrow’s game against Cheltenham as well as our home fixture against Morecambe next weekend.

"Wellens has also been fined £1,000 following the charge."
